Assistance with Utilities

Can I get any help paying my gas, electric, telephone and water bills?

There are financial assistance programs available to help low-income households with their utility bills. The Department of Economic Security administers several different programs that help with utility deposits, payments, discounts, weatherization of homes, and some appliance repair and replacement. Contact the Department of Economic Security at their state-wide toll free number, (800)582-5706 for information about eligibility and application requirements. They can also help you locate other agencies and programs in your local area.
